ProcessModelSection.CpuMask Proprietà
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Ottiene o imposta un valore che indica i processori in un server multiprocessore idonei all'esecuzione dei processi ASP.NET.
public:
property int CpuMask { int get(); void set(int value); };
[System.Configuration.ConfigurationProperty("cpuMask", DefaultValue="0xffffffff")]
public int CpuMask { get; set; }
[<System.Configuration.ConfigurationProperty("cpuMask", DefaultValue="0xffffffff")>]
member this.CpuMask : int with get, set
Public Property CpuMask As Integer
Valore della proprietà
Numero che rappresenta il modello di bit da applicare. Il valore predefinito è 0xFFFFFFFF.
- Attributi
Esempio
Nell'esempio di codice seguente viene illustrato come accedere alla proprietà CpuMask.
// Get the current CpuMask property value.
int cpuMask =
processModelSection.CpuMask;
// Set the CpuMask property to 0x000000FF.
processModelSection.CpuMask = 0x000000FF;
' Get the current CpuMask property value.
Dim cpuMask As Integer = _
processModelSection.CpuMask
' Set the CpuMask property to 0x000000FF.
processModelSection.CpuMask = &HFF
Commenti
Il CpuMask valore specifica un modello di bit che indica le CPU idonee per l'esecuzione ASP.NET thread. Se la WebGarden proprietà è impostata su true
, limita i CpuMask processi di lavoro al numero di CPU idonee. Il numero massimo consentito di processi di lavoro è uguale al numero di CPU. Per impostazione predefinita, tutte le CPU sono abilitate e ASP.NET avvia un processo per ogni CPU. Se la WebGarden proprietà è impostata su false
, l'attributo CpuMask viene ignorato e verrà eseguito un solo processo di lavoro.